Survey finds Berks people back rail line, reject tolling Route 422 to pay for it

From the Reading Eagle (07/29/10):

 

The results are in: Most people want a passenger rail line from Wyomissing to Norristown, but virtually no one wants to pay for it.

Survey results released Wednesday show overwhelming support of the Norristown Extension, previously called the R-6 Extension, that supporters say would bring jobs, tourists and new residents to the area.
